Easy Quiche
2 tbs. Butter
½ cup Onion, minced
1 cup Chopped ham
1- 9 inch pie crust, unbaked
3 Eggs
½ tsp. Salt
¼ tsp. Black pepper
¾ cup Italian cheese blend
Blend all of the ingredients together in a small bowl and set aside. Place the
unbaked pie crust into a pie pan, if not already in one. Center the pie pan on the
baking tray and place in the oven. Close the cover. Turn the oven on, select the
“BAKE” function, use both oven elements and set the timer for 5 minutes. Press
“COOK” to confirm the settings and begin the cooking process. When the 5 minutes
has elapsed, open the cover, remove the pie crust and pour the egg mixture into the
prepared pie crust. Place the pie crust back in to the oven and close the cover.
Turn the oven on, select the “BAKE” function, and set the timer for approximately 23
minutes. Press “COOK” to confirm the settings and begin the cooking process.
Herb Focaccias
1 can Pillsbury Grands buttermilk biscuits, 8 big biscuits
8 tsp. Olive oil
4 Garlic cloves, finely chopped
8 tbs. Basil leaves, fresh or dried
8 tbs. Fresh parmesan cheese
Place four biscuits on to the baking tray, evenly spaced. Press or roll each biscuit to
approximately 4 inches round. Brush the tops of the biscuits with the olive oil.
Sprinkle with garlic, basil, and parmesan cheese. Place the baking tray in the oven
and close the cover. Turn the oven on, select the “BAKE” function, and set the timer
for 9 minutes or until the edges are golden brown. Press “COOK” to confirm the
settings and begin the cooking process.
